Dozens of Ancient Amphorae Unearthed from Byzantine Shipwreck off Greek Coast

In a remarkable ⁤archaeological discovery, marine explorers have⁤ unearthed dozens of amphorae ‍from a long-lost⁣ Byzantine shipwreck off⁢ the coast of Greece.This significant find, reported by​ Greek Reporter, offers a tantalizing​ glimpse into maritime trade and daily life ⁤during the Byzantine Empire, shedding light on the era’s‍ economic and cultural exchanges.The amphorae,which‍ are large ⁤ceramic vessels typically used for transporting goods such as olive oil and wine,underscore the sophistication of ancient trade networks and ‍the craftsmanship of the era. As researchers continue to investigate⁣ the site, this discovery promises to enrich our understanding ‌of greece’s rich maritime history and its pivotal role in the Mediterranean‍ trade routes of ​the⁤ past.

Significance of the Amphorae Discovery in Understanding Byzantine Trade

Significance‌ of⁢ the Amphorae​ Discovery in Understanding ‌Byzantine Trade

The discovery of amphorae from‍ the ancient Byzantine shipwreck offers invaluable insights into the intricacies of trade practices during this pivotal ⁢period. These ceramic vessels were primarily used for transporting liquids like ⁣wine and oil,​ but ‌their significance extends beyond mere functionality. Analyzing the shapes, sizes, and markings on the amphorae can shed⁤ light‌ on the economic relationships between different⁤ regions, ​revealing how far⁣ trade networks stretched throughout the Mediterranean. As an example,‌ distinct styles and construction techniques can indicate the origin of ⁢the‍ goods and even quests for ⁢quality in trade.

Furthermore,‌ the amphorae serve ⁤as ⁤a tangible testament to the cultural exchanges that occurred during the Byzantine era.The trade routes not only facilitated⁢ commerce but‌ also allowed ​for the ‌movement‍ of ideas and artistic‌ influences across vast distances.Some notable ‌insights from the⁢ amphorae​ recovered can include:

  • Geographical‌ Origins: Identification of‌ specific regions associated with ​the ‍amphorae can highlight trade relationships.
  • Trade Volumes: The ⁢number of amphorae​ recovered indicates the scale of⁤ trade⁢ activity.
  • Economic Shifts: ⁤ Changes ⁤in amphora forms over time may reflect evolving economic conditions.
